Abstract

The utility model discloses a biochemical incubator which comprises an outer box body, one side of one end of the outer box body is movably hinged with an outer box door, one end in the outer box body is fixedly connected with an end plate, the center line of the end plate and the center line of the outer box body are on the same vertical plane, one side of the outer box body is fixedly connected with a control panel, and the control panel is fixedly connected with the outer box body. An isolation structure used for isolating the cultivation space is arranged in the outer box body. According to the biochemical incubator, through the arrangement of the partition plate, after the movable baffle is pressed to be separated from one end of the positioning piece in the microorganism cultivation process, the inner box door can be pulled to be opened, so that a culture dish is conveniently placed at the top end of the placing plate in the outer box body, and then the inner box door is closed; the movable baffle is ejected out by the spring and attached to one end of the positioning piece so that the inner box door can be positioned through the positioning piece, the interior of the outer box body can be divided into a plurality of spaces through the multiple sets of partition plates in the outer box body so that separated cultivation can be facilitated, and the problem that the cultivation space cannot be effectively isolated is solved.

Technical Field

[0001] This utility model relates to the field of incubator technology, specifically a biochemical incubator. Background Technology

[0002] In the field of biology, when studying microorganisms, it is necessary to culture microorganisms in batches to meet the research requirements. In order to avoid the microorganisms being affected by various external factors during the culture process, the culture dishes for culturing microorganisms are usually placed in a special incubator. This incubator needs to have the function of adjusting the internal environment according to the growth environment requirements of microorganisms in order to facilitate unified management and control.

[0003] However, the incubators currently used for microbial cultivation still have some shortcomings in use. During the cultivation of microorganisms, it is not possible to effectively isolate the culture space according to the type of microorganism, which makes it inconvenient to control and adjust.

[0004] A novel biochemical incubator is proposed to address the aforementioned problems. Utility Model Content

[0005] The purpose of this invention is to provide a biochemical incubator to solve the problem mentioned in the background art of the inability to effectively isolate the cultivation space.

[0015] Compared with the prior art, the beneficial effects of this utility model are: the biochemical incubator not only achieves the isolation of the cultivation space and the convenient storage and retrieval of the culture dishes, but also achieves unified temperature control;

[0016] By incorporating partitions, movable baffles, grooves, hinge slots, hinge plates, springs, movable slots, positioning plates, inner doors, and viewing windows, during the microbial cultivation process, pressing the movable baffle to detach it from one end of the positioning plate allows the inner door to be pulled open, facilitating the placement of the culture dish onto the top of the placement plate inside the outer box. After closing the inner door, the spring pushes the movable baffle out and attaches it to one end of the positioning plate, thus positioning the inner door. Multiple sets of partitions inside the outer box can divide the interior into multiple spaces for separate cultivation, achieving the ability to isolate cultivation spaces.

[0017] The system is equipped with a placement plate, partition, limiting rod, fixing cylinder, end plate, through hole, and cylinder. When it is necessary to place a culture dish, the inner door inside the outer box is opened, and then the cylinder inside the outer box is activated through the control panel. The cylinder can push the placement plate to move through the fixing cylinder, pushing the placement plate out of the outer box to facilitate the placement of the culture dish. After the placement is in place, the cylinder is activated again to send the placement plate back into the outer box. The limiting rod at one end of the end plate fits into the through hole to support the placement plate, ensuring the stability of the placement plate during movement. This system allows for convenient storage and retrieval of culture dishes.

[0018] Equipped with a heat-conducting window, vent, heating chamber, electric heating box, end plate, electric heating tube, and heat-conducting plate, the electric heating box can be started via the control panel during the microbial cultivation process. The electric heating box heats the electric heating tube, which in turn raises the temperature inside the heating chamber and conducts the heat to the inside of the heat-conducting plate. The vent at one end of the heat-conducting window can introduce heat into the outer chamber, thereby quickly controlling the stability of the outer chamber. The interconnected structure of the heating chamber can maintain a uniform temperature in all spaces inside the outer chamber, achieving unified control of the cultivation temperature.
